We revisit the parametric decay instability of arc-polarized Alfvén waves. Three dimensional magnetohydrodynamic (MHD) simulations show that the growth of decay instabilities of “shear” component of arc-polarized waves is in good agreement with linear growth rates of circularly polarized waves with effective value (root-mean-squared) amplitude. Daughter waves of the decay instability including “compressible” components of arc-polarized waves, whose frequency is twice as high as the shear component frequency, is also observed.
